.wp-block-coffee-friend-shop-leave-review .leave-review-popup{background-color:rgba(0,0,0,.6);height:100%;left:0;position:fixed;top:0;width:100%;z-index:1000}.wp-block-coffee-friend-shop-leave-review .leave-review-popup .content{height:100vh;left:0;max-width:1820px;overflow-y:auto;position:fixed;top:0;width:100%;--tw-bg-opacity:1;background-color:rgba(255,255,255,var(--tw-bg-opacity));font-size:14px;font-weight:300;letter-spacing:.035px;line-height:25px;padding:16px 12px 24px}@media (min-width:1024px){.wp-block-coffee-friend-shop-leave-review .leave-review-popup .content{border-radius:16px;bottom:0;display:flex;height:-webkit-fit-content;height:-moz-fit-content;height:fit-content;left:0;margin:auto;overflow:hidden;padding:48px;right:0;top:0;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;--tw-shadow:0 4px 6px -1px rgba(0,0,0,.1),0 2px 4px -2px rgba(0,0,0,.1);--tw-shadow-colored:0 4px 6px -1px var(--tw-shadow-color),0 2px 4px -2px var(--tw-shadow-color);box-shadow:var(--tw-ring-offset-shadow,0 0 transparent),var(--tw-ring-shadow,0 0 transparent),var(--tw-shadow)}}.wp-block-coffee-friend-shop-leave-review .leave-review-popup .content .success-message{align-items:center;bottom:0;display:flex;flex-direction:column;height:100%;justify-content:center;position:fixed;width:100%;--tw-bg-opacity:1;background-color:rgba(255,255,255,var(--tw-bg-opacity));font-size:18px;line-height:24px}@media (min-width:1024px){.wp-block-coffee-friend-shop-leave-review .leave-review-popup .content .success-message{position:absolute;width:calc(100% - 96px)}}.wp-block-coffee-friend-shop-leave-review .leave-review-popup .content .success-message:before{align-items:center;border-radius:9999px;border-width:2px;content:"\e941";display:flex;height:40px;justify-content:center;margin-bottom:15px;width:40px;--tw-border-opacity:1;border-color:rgba(0,0,0,var(--tw-border-opacity));font-family:coffee-friend-icons;font-size:135%}.wp-block-coffee-friend-shop-leave-review .leave-review-popup .content .form-field{display:flex;flex-direction:column;gap:8px;margin-top:32px}.wp-block-coffee-friend-shop-leave-review .leave-review-popup .content .form-field label{line-height:16px}.wp-block-coffee-friend-shop-leave-review .leave-review-popup .content .comment-form-rating .stars{height:20px;margin:0}.wp-block-coffee-friend-shop-leave-review .leave-review-popup .content .comment-form-rating .stars a{color:transparent;display:inline-block;float:left;height:20px;letter-spacing:4px;line-height:20px;overflow:hidden;-webkit-text-decoration-line:none;text-decoration-line:none;width:18px}.wp-block-coffee-friend-shop-leave-review .leave-review-popup .content .comment-form-rating .stars a:before{content:"\e90e";font-family:coffee-friend-icons;font-size:16px;height:20px;--tw-text-opacity:1;color:rgba(231,231,225,var(--tw-text-opacity))}.wp-block-coffee-friend-shop-leave-review .leave-review-popup .content .comment-form-rating .stars.selected a:before,.wp-block-coffee-friend-shop-leave-review .leave-review-popup .content .comment-form-rating .stars:hover a:before{--tw-text-opacity:1;color:rgba(255,192,29,var(--tw-text-opacity))}.wp-block-coffee-friend-shop-leave-review .leave-review-popup .content .comment-form-rating .stars a:hover~a:before,.wp-block-coffee-friend-shop-leave-review .leave-review-popup .content .comment-form-rating .stars.selected a.active~a:before{--tw-text-opacity:1;color:rgba(231,231,225,var(--tw-text-opacity))}.wp-block-coffee-friend-shop-leave-review .leave-review-popup .content .comment-form-rating .stars .br-active:before,.wp-block-coffee-friend-shop-leave-review .leave-review-popup .content .comment-form-rating .stars .br-selected:before,.wp-block-coffee-friend-shop-leave-review .leave-review-popup .content .comment-form-rating .stars a.active:before{border-width:0;--tw-text-opacity:1;color:rgba(255,192,29,var(--tw-text-opacity))}.wp-block-coffee-friend-shop-leave-review .leave-review-popup .content .close-popup{cursor:pointer;font-size:24px;height:24px;position:absolute;right:20px;top:20px;width:24px}.wp-block-coffee-friend-shop-leave-review .leave-review-popup .content .close-popup:before{content:"\e909";font-family:coffee-friend-icons;font-size:24px}.wp-block-coffee-friend-shop-leave-review .shop-review .ratings{display:flex;flex-direction:row;justify-content:space-between}.wp-block-coffee-friend-shop-leave-review .shop-review .ratings .star-rating .stars{margin-left:0}@media (min-width:1024px){.wp-block-coffee-friend-shop-leave-review .shop-review .ratings .star-rating .stars{margin-bottom:23px}}.wp-block-coffee-friend-shop-leave-review .shop-review .ratings .star-rating .stars span:before,.wp-block-coffee-friend-shop-leave-review .shop-review .ratings .star-rating .stars:before{font-size:12px;font-weight:400;line-height:16px}@media (min-width:1024px){.wp-block-coffee-friend-shop-leave-review .shop-review .ratings .star-rating .stars span:before,.wp-block-coffee-friend-shop-leave-review .shop-review .ratings .star-rating .stars:before{font-size:16px}}.wp-block-coffee-friend-shop-leave-review .shop-review[data-type=trustpilot_review] .ratings .star-rating .stars span:before{--tw-text-opacity:1;color:rgba(0,190,99,var(--tw-text-opacity))}.wp-block-coffee-friend-shop-leave-review .trust-shop-widget.etrusted{border-radius:16px;height:50px;max-width:215px;width:100%;--tw-bg-opacity:1;background-color:rgba(255,255,255,var(--tw-bg-opacity));padding:10px;--tw-shadow:0px 4px 16px 0px rgba(0,0,0,.1);--tw-shadow-colored:0px 4px 16px 0px var(--tw-shadow-color);box-shadow:var(--tw-ring-offset-shadow,0 0 transparent),var(--tw-ring-shadow,0 0 transparent),var(--tw-shadow)}@media (min-width:1024px){.wp-block-coffee-friend-shop-leave-review .trust-shop-widget.etrusted{border-radius:8px;height:75px;max-width:-webkit-fit-content;max-width:-moz-fit-content;max-width:fit-content;padding:24px;--tw-shadow:0 0 transparent;--tw-shadow-colored:0 0 transparent;box-shadow:var(--tw-ring-offset-shadow,0 0 transparent),var(--tw-ring-shadow,0 0 transparent),var(--tw-shadow)}}.wp-block-coffee-friend-shop-leave-review .trust-shop-widget.etrusted etrusted-widget{margin-bottom:-10px;margin-left:auto;margin-right:auto;width:180px}